Kinds Of Elegant Fireplaces

When selecting a sophisticated fireplace, it’s crucial to think about the type that best fits your home’s design and your personal preferences. Below is a table summing up the most typical types of elegant fireplaces (simply click the next web page):

Type Description Pros Cons
Wood-Burning Conventional fireplace that uses logs for fuel Genuine ambiance, terrific heat output Needs routine upkeep, can produce smoke
Gas Uses gas or lp, typically with a switch for easy operation Clean-burning, simple to use, instant heat Requires a gas line, can be less aesthetically appealing
Electric Operates on electrical energy, often featuring sensible flame simulations No venting needed, simple setup, low maintenance Less heat output compared to wood or gas options
Pellet Burns compressed wood pellets, offering an environmentally friendly alternative Efficient and clean-burning, produces less ash Requires electrical energy, can be more costly to install
Ethanol Uses bioethanol fuel, which burns cleanly without the need for venting Versatile style options, can be utilized indoors Limited heat output, fuel can be costly
Corner Designed to fit snugly in a corner, making the most of area while keeping elegance Space-saving, enhances space circulation May need customized style for setup

Frequently Asked Questions About Elegant Fireplaces

Q1: What is the most effective type of fireplace?

A1: Gas fireplaces tend to be the most effective, as they offer instant heat and can be managed quickly. Wood-burning fireplaces can also be effective if geared up with an EPA-certified insert.

Q2: Do electrical fireplaces really provide heat?

A2: Yes, electrical fireplaces create heat, although they might not be as effective as wood or gas designs. They are perfect for enhancing atmosphere and providing extra heating.

Q3: How do I preserve my fireplace?

A3: Maintenance depends upon the kind of fireplace. Wood-burning systems need regular chimney cleansings, while gas fireplaces must be examined periodically for any leakages. Electric fireplaces typically require very little maintenance.

Q4: Can I set up a fireplace myself?

A4: Some easier designs, such as electrical fireplaces, can be installed by property owners. However, more complex installations, specifically gas and wood-burning designs, should be managed by professionals.
